服务器证书有什么功效

不及物动词 其他 13

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器证书是用来确保网络通信安全的一种安全协议。它具有以下几个功效:

    1. 加密通信:服务器证书可以通过对传输的数据进行加密,确保只有发送和接收方能够解密和读取传输的信息。这样可以有效防止黑客和恶意攻击者截取敏感数据。

    2. 身份验证:服务器证书提供了一种验证服务器身份的方式。当客户端访问一个网站时,服务器会发送自己的证书给客户端,客户端可以通过验证证书的合法性来确认该服务器的身份。这可以确保客户端与合法服务器进行通信,避免了被伪装服务器进行欺骗的风险。

    3. 防止中间人攻击:中间人攻击是一种在通信过程中恶意第三方截取通信数据并篡改的攻击方式。服务器证书中的公钥可以用来验证数据的完整性,确保数据传输过程中没有被篡改。

    4. 提供信任:用户访问网站时,浏览器会根据服务器证书的合法性与信任级别来给予提示。如果服务器证书是由受信任的第三方机构颁发的,浏览器会显示安全标志,提高用户信任感。

    总之,服务器证书通过加密通信、身份验证、防止中间人攻击和提供信任等功效,确保了服务器与客户端之间的安全通信。它对于保障用户数据的安全性和防止网络攻击具有重要作用。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器证书是一种数字证书,主要用于加密和验证在网络通信中传输的数据。服务器证书具有以下功效:

    1. 安全通信:服务器证书使用公钥加密算法,能够加密通过网络传输的敏感数据。这样即使在网络传输过程中被中间人截获,也无法破解和窃取数据。

    2. 身份验证:服务器证书包含服务器的公共密钥和相关信息,由可信的第三方机构(如CA机构)签发。客户端在与服务器建立连接时,可以使用服务器证书验证服务器的身份,避免与伪装的服务器建立连接,防止黑客攻击和欺骗。

    3. 数据完整性保护:服务器证书中包含数字签名,用于保护数据的完整性。客户端在接收服务器返回的数据时,可以使用服务器证书中的数字签名验证数据是否被篡改过。

    4. 支持HTTPS协议:服务器证书是支持HTTPS(安全超文本传输协议)的基础。HTTPS协议通过在HTTP协议之上加入SSL/TLS协议来实现数据的加密传输和身份验证。

    5. 信任建立:服务器证书由被广泛认可和信任的第三方机构签发,这些机构会对服务器进行安全审计和认证。当服务器使用有效的服务器证书时,用户可以信任服务器的安全性,提高用户对网站或应用程序的信任度。

    总之,服务器证书在网络通信中起着至关重要的作用,能够保护数据的安全性和完整性,验证服务器的身份,并建立用户对服务器的信任。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器证书在网络通信中扮演着重要的角色,主要具有以下几个功效:

    1. 验证服务器身份:服务器证书用于验证服务器的身份,确保用户与服务器的通信是安全的。证书中包含了服务器的公钥、标识信息以及数字签名等,客户端可以通过验证证书的合法性来确认服务器的身份,防止遭受伪造服务器的攻击。可以确保用户连接的是真实的服务器,而不是中间人攻击者。

    2. 加密通信数据:服务器证书中包含了服务器的公钥,客户端可以使用这个公钥来进行加密通信。在建立安全连接后,客户端和服务器之间的通信数据会使用公钥进行加密,保护数据的机密性,防止被窃听和篡改。

    3. 保护用户隐私:服务器证书可以保护用户的隐私信息。在用户与服务器建立安全连接后,通信过程中的敏感信息(如用户名、密码等)都会经过加密,防止被恶意用户窃取。

    4. 提供身份认证:服务器证书中的数字签名用于证明证书的真实性和完整性。客户端可以通过验证数字签名来确认证书的合法性,从而信任服务器,避免受到伪造证书的攻击。

    5. 提升网站信誉度:拥有有效的服务器证书可以提升网站的信誉度和可信度。在用户访问网站时,浏览器会检查服务器证书的有效性,如果证书有效,会显示安全锁或绿色地址栏等标识,向用户传递网站是安全的信号。

    操作流程如下:

    1. 申请证书:服务器证书通常需要从可信的第三方证书颁发机构(CA)进行申请和颁发。首先,服务器管理员需要生成一对公钥和私钥,并生成证书签名请求(CSR)。然后将CSR及相关信息提交给CA机构,由CA机构进行验证和签名。

    2. 验证服务器身份:CA机构会对服务器管理员和域名进行验证,确保服务器的合法性和真实性。通常有多种验证方式,如域名验证、组织验证和扩展验证等。

    3. 颁发证书:经过验证后,CA机构将会颁发服务器证书。证书中包含了服务器的公钥、标识信息和数字签名等。

    4. 安装证书:服务器管理员需要将颁发的证书安装到服务器上。这包括将证书文件导入到服务器端,并进行相应的配置修改,以便服务器能够使用证书建立安全连接。

    5. 配置HTTPS:在服务器上,需要对相关的网络服务进行配置,以支持HTTPS协议。这包括修改服务器配置文件,启用SSL/TLS协议等。

    6. 验证证书有效性:服务器管理员需要测试和验证证书的有效性,确保服务器可以正常使用证书建立安全连接。可以通过各种工具和服务进行验证,如SSL检测工具、在线证书验证服务等。

    总结起来,服务器证书的功效包括验证服务器身份、加密通信数据、保护用户隐私、提供身份认证和提升网站信誉度。通过申请、验证、颁发和安装证书,并配置相关网络服务,服务器管理员可以确保服务器的安全连接和可信度。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部